Given below are four statements pertaining to separation of DNA fragments using gel electrophoresis. Identify the incorrect statements.
(a) DNA is negatively charged molecule and so it is loaded on gel towards the Anode terminal.
(b) DNA fragments travel along the surface of the gel whose concentration does not affect movement of DNA.
(c) Smaller the size of DNA fragment larger is the distance it travels through it.
(d) Pure DNA can be visualized directly by exposing UV radiation.
Choose correct answer from the options given below

a

(a), (b) and (c)

b

(b), (c) and (d)

c

(a), (c) and (d)

d

(a), (b) and (d)

answer is D.

Detailed Solution

detailed_solution_thumbnail

DNA is negatively charged molecule and so it is loaded on gel towards the cathode terminal.

Concentration of agar is inversely proportional to the distance travelled by DNA fragments.

The separated DNA fragments can be visualised only after staining the DNA with a compound known as ethidium bromide followed by exposure to UV radiation (you cannot see pure DNA fragments in the visible light and without staining).
